2 ideas:
1) A multiple benchmarks competition ( pointing system for each ranking, and total pts determine the winner )
e.g. 3D Mark 2001SE, CPU Limit 5GHz and nature cap at 1400 fps
SuperPi 32M, CPU Limit 5GHz
PC Mark 2005, 1 SSD only and 5GHz CPU Limit.
2) One benchmark per prize, or category ( e.g. SuperPi 32M, prize #1 = fastest 2600K @ 5GHz, prize #2 = fastest LGA1366 Core i7 @ 4.5GHz, prize #3 = fastest LGA1156 Core @ 4.5GHz, prize #4 = fastest superpi ( no clock & platform limits )... etc
